Condividi tramite


ApplicationTypeApplicationsHealthEvaluation

Rappresenta la valutazione dell'integrità per le applicazioni di un particolare tipo di applicazione. La valutazione delle applicazioni con tipo di applicazione può essere restituita quando la valutazione dell'integrità del cluster restituisce uno stato di integrità aggregato non integro, errore o avviso. Contiene valutazioni di integrità per ogni applicazione non integra del tipo di applicazione incluso che ha interessato lo stato di integrità aggregato corrente.

Proprietà

Nome Tipo Necessario
AggregatedHealthState string (enum) No
Description string No
ApplicationTypeName string No
MaxPercentUnhealthyApplications integer No
TotalCount integer (int64) No
UnhealthyEvaluations matrice di HealthEvaluationWrapper No

AggregatedHealthState

Tipo: string (enum)
Obbligatorio: No

Stato di integrità di un'entità di Service Fabric, ad esempio Cluster, Node, Application, Service, Partition, Replica e così via.

I valori possibili sono:

  • Invalid - Indica uno stato di integrità non valido. Tutte le enumerazioni di Service Fabric hanno il tipo non valido. Il valore predefinito è zero.
  • Ok - Indica che lo stato di integrità è corretto. Il valore è uguale a 1.
  • Warning - Indica che lo stato di integrità è a livello di avviso. Il valore è 2.
  • Error - Indica che lo stato di integrità è a livello di errore. Lo stato di integrità degli errori deve essere analizzato, perché può influire sulla funzionalità corretta del cluster. Il valore è 3.
  • Unknown - Indica uno stato di integrità sconosciuto. Il valore è 65535.

Description

Tipo: string
Obbligatorio: No

Descrizione della valutazione dell'integrità, che rappresenta un riepilogo del processo di valutazione.


ApplicationTypeName

Tipo: string
Obbligatorio: No

Nome del tipo di applicazione definito nel manifesto dell'applicazione.


MaxPercentUnhealthyApplications

Tipo: integer
Obbligatorio: No

Percentuale massima consentita di applicazioni non integre per il tipo di applicazione, specificata come voce in ApplicationTypeHealthPolicyMap.


TotalCount

Tipo: integer (int64)
Obbligatorio: No

Numero totale di applicazioni del tipo di applicazione trovato nell'archivio integrità.


UnhealthyEvaluations

Tipo: matrice di HealthEvaluationWrapper
Obbligatorio: No

Elenco di valutazioni non integre che hanno portato allo stato di integrità aggregato. Include tutte le applicazioni non integreHealthEvaluation di questo tipo di applicazione che hanno interessato l'integrità aggregata.